The Nemzeti Bajnokság I/B (English: National Championship I/B) is the second tier league for Hungarian women's handball clubs. It is administered by the Hungarian Handball Federation. The league is divided into two groups, a Western one and an Eastern one. Fourteen teams compete in each group and the group winners gain automatic promotion to the NB I.
